The Hardware Engineering directorate leads in the mechanical hardware design, development, and production of weapons systems. We use state-of-the-art tools, processes, and technology, with capabilities encompassing a broad range of technical disciplines, including product engineering, manufacturing, technical services, materials engineering, analysis and test, rapid hardware development/builds and configuration and data management documentation.
The Rapid Hardware Solutions (RHS) department within Mechanical Engineering is chartered to deliver agile services. We bridge across Operations and Engineering, providing solutions through the execution of quick-turn design, procurement, manufacturing, and environmental test services.
RHS is skilled in special test equipment, program trainers, environmental test, and cooling systems mechanical design. We utilize Creo and Common Product Data Management (PDM) with tailored release processes for maximum cross-use and flexibility.
RHS executes prototyping and high-mix/low-rate procurement and fabrication activities with a focus on in-house electro-mechanical packaging, support equipment and liquid cooling systems integration, and partner with outside suppliers to satisfy all demands. We strive to minimize cycle times and provide best value through the utilization of dynamic and agile processes.
This role is for a Section Leader of the Program Trainers Section for RHS in Tewksbury, MA. The purpose of this section is to support the design, build and fly away support of the Trainers product lines. Serving primarily PATRIOT customers, the Trainers group is unique in that they are involved at every step of the production process. Participating in proposals, leading large design efforts, supporting procurement & build efforts, and spearheading fly-away support and sell-off, Trainers is a one-stop-shop for all ME needs. Primary product lines include the Reconfigurable Tabletop Trainers (RT3’s), Patriot Maintenance Trainers (PMT’s) and Communication Operations Trainers (COT’s).
